RTX 5050 vs RTX 5060: Specs Breakdown
| Specification | RTX 5050 | RTX 5060 |
|---|---|---|
| Architecture | Blackwell | Blackwell |
| CUDA Cores | Base count | 50% more cores |
| Memory Type | GDDR6 | GDDR7 |
| Memory Bandwidth | Standard | 40% larger |
| Compute Power | 13.2 TFLOPS | 19.2 TFLOPS (40% faster) |
| Power Draw | Under 150W | Under 150W |
| DLSS Support | DLSS 4 with MFG | DLSS 4 with MFG |
| Current Price | $249 | $280-$330 |
Performance: Where the Gap Becomes Critical
At 1080p resolution, the RTX 5050 averages 61 FPS across modern titles—respectable performance for a $250 card. However, the RTX 5060 delivers substantially higher framerates across the board, with a crucial advantage: it maintains playable performance in demanding titles like Mafia The Old Country where the 5050 struggles.

This playability threshold matters more than raw numbers. As new games launch in coming months, the performance gap will increasingly separate smooth gameplay from stuttering frustration.

Value Proposition: FPS Per Dollar Analysis
Here’s where the decision becomes clear-cut. The RTX 5050 delivers 0.245 FPS per dollar, while the RTX 5060 achieves 0.27 FPS per dollar—approximately 10% better value despite the higher price tag.
Why the RTX 5060 Wins on Value:
- Better framerates in all tested games
- Playable performance in more demanding titles
- 50% more CUDA cores for future-proofing
- GDDR7 memory provides bandwidth headroom
- 40% higher compute power (19.2 vs 13.2 TFLOPS)
The $30-50 premium translates directly to measurably better gaming experiences rather than just marginal improvements.
Blackwell Architecture Benefits
Both cards leverage Nvidia’s latest Blackwell architecture, providing tighter hardware integration for superior upscaling performance. DLSS 4 with multi-frame generation comes standard, though the newer Transformer-based upscaling models and 3x/4x MFG presets can introduce stuttering despite high average framerates.
This means both cards benefit equally from Nvidia’s AI-powered features, but the 5060’s superior raw horsepower handles the computational overhead more gracefully.

Power Efficiency Advantage
Both GPUs draw under 150W, making them ideal for entry-level builds with modest power supplies. This efficiency allows builders to allocate budget toward other components like faster storage or better cooling without upgrading PSUs.

Current Pricing and Availability
The RTX 5050 maintains its $249 MSRP consistently, while Black Friday deals pushed the RTX 5060 down to $280 for base models. Premium triple-fan variants reach $330, but even at that price, the performance advantage justifies the investment for most gamers.
The Verdict: RTX 5060 Wins
Despite the RTX 5050’s appeal as a budget option, it simply isn’t cheap enough to justify the performance compromises. The RTX 5060’s superior compute power, GDDR7 memory, and 10% better FPS-per-dollar value make it the objectively smarter purchase for anyone building a gaming PC in late 2025.
Choose RTX 5060 if:
- You want maximum 1080p performance
- Future-proofing matters for your build
- $30-50 extra fits your budget
- You play demanding AAA titles
Choose RTX 5050 only if:
- Your budget absolutely cannot stretch
- You play less demanding esports titles exclusively
- You plan to upgrade within 12 months
